Android 16 consists of a great split-screen multitasking system, permitting one application to take control of 90% of the display room while the 2nd application inhabits the staying 10%. This is very comparable to OPPO’s Limitless Sight and OnePlus’s OpenCanvas multitasking systems. However did OPPO in fact contribute this function to Google for Android 16?

OPPO exec Zhu Haizhou asserted on Weibo previously today that Android 16’s 90:10 split display function was a “little payment from OPPO” to Google. Take a look at the machine-translated screenshot listed below.

Nevertheless, we asked OPPO to make clear whether it had certainly officially added this function to Google:

The Google ’90:10 ′ split-screen multitasking function you discussed certainly attracts motivation from OPPO’s Limitless Sight. Limitless Sight is a productivity-enhancing function initially presented on the OPPO Discover N3 in 2023 and consequently included our bar-style phones, the Discover X8 Collection, through ColorOS 15 in 2014. It dramatically broadens functional display room and redefines the multitasking experience.

We delight in to see that Google has actually acknowledged the worth of this cutting-edge idea and has actually currently integrated a comparable function right into Android 16.

Simply put, OPPO really did not in fact contribute this function to Google for Android 16, and it’s just a “comparable function.” This isn’t a shock, however, as Google has actually long gotten hold of functions introduced by OEMs and included them in supply Android.

Despite the function’s beginnings, we rejoice to see Google bringing a much-loved OPPO and OnePlus include to equip Android. This unlocks for tons of various other brand names to embrace this unique multitasking choice. As a matter of fact, Samsung has actually currently embraced it in the One UI 8 beta on the Galaxy S25 collection.
